For long-range hunters and shooters who expect performance without compromise, the Thrive HD 6-24x50mm PHR II riflescope delivers precise tracking and HD clarity in all light conditions. Designed to provide unmatched value and accuracy, this optic brings field-proven reliability to every shot.
The PHR II reticle provides a fine floating centre dot and subtle holdover marks, ensuring exact aiming at any range. With its unobtrusive layout, you can make fast, confident adjustments without obscuring your target. Whether zeroing for the range or connecting on distant game, it’s built for focus, accuracy, and control.
The 6-24x magnification range and 50mm objective lens combine for sharp, bright imagery across distances. A 30mm aluminium tube offers durability and consistent light transmission, while capped turrets deliver 0.25 MOA adjustments that hold true through recoil and weather.
With 92% light transmission, Weathershield coatings, and heavy-duty HD flip-up covers, this riflescope ensures visibility and protection in any terrain. Trusted by New Zealand hunters, the Thrive HD 6-24x50 is built to excel when precision and reliability matter most.

| Focal Plane | Second (SFP) |
|---|---|
| Magnification | 6-24x |
| Reticle calibrated magnification power (SFP only) | - |
| Objective Lens Diameter | 50mm |
| Maintube Diameter | 30mm |
| Reticle type | PHR 2 |
| Zero Stop | No |
| Parallax Adjustment Range | 10m (11yd) - Infinity |
| Turret Index Value | 0.25 MOA |
| Exit Pupil Diameter | Low: 8.3mm; High: 2.08mm |
| Eye Relief | 3.74in (95mm) |
| Diopter Adjustment | - |
| Internal Elevation Adjustment | 70 MOA |
| Internal Windage Adjustment | 70 MOA |
| Field of View @ 100 Meters | Low: 5.9m; High: 1.5m |
| Field of View @ 100 Yards | Low: 17.7ft; High: 4.5ft |
| Maintube Material | 6061-T6 |
| Weight | 26.9oz (764g) |
| Lens Coating | FMC |
| Available Reticles | LR HUNTER Illuminated, PHR 2, PHR 2 Illuminated |
| Illumination | No |
| Recommended Use | Big Game Hunting - Backcountry, Long Range Shooting / Precision Shooting, Rimfire / Plinking |
| Objective Outer Diameter | 57.5mm |
| Ocular Outer Diameter | 43.5mm |
| Waterproof Rating | IPX7 |
| Colour | Black |

The PHR II shares all the features of the PHR reticle with the addition of a floating center dot for an ultra-refined point of aim as well as a finer 6 o’clock post, enabling even more precise elevation ‘hold overs’.
Unobtrusive elevation holds are available at 1.1, 2.5, 5, 10, 15, 20 and 25 MOA, allowing the shooter to maximize the potential of their rifle and ammunition combination.
